公开(公告)号:US11271853B2
公开(公告)日:2022-03-08
申请号:US16805293
申请日:2020-02-28
Applicant: Huawei Technologies Co., Ltd.
Inventor: Han Zhou , Runze Zhou
IPC: H04L12/753 , H04L45/48 , H04L69/325 , H04L12/66 , H04L69/16 , H04L41/044 , H04L45/64 , H04L41/0806 , H04L41/0853
Abstract: This application discloses a gateway configuration method and a gateway device, so as to resolve problems of a relatively heavy configuration workload, update inflexibility, and low configuration efficiency that exist when an OM entity is used to uniformly configure gateways in an LTE system. The method includes: configuring, by a control plane gateway, a parameter for a user plane gateway, and sending, by the control plane gateway, a configuration message to the user plane gateway, where the configuration message carries the configuration parameter configured by the control plane gateway for the user plane gateway. In this application, the control plane gateway configures the parameter for the user plane gateway, so that the control plane gateway implements configuration of the user plane gateway, and configuration flexibility and configuration efficiency are improved.
